Praying for our world seems like a huge task to undertake. With over 7 billion people living in it, you might think it's just easier to pray for our nation or our cities and that's it. It's amazing that God is the El Shaddai, the God Almighty! He is all powerful and nothing is too hard for Him. Because God is Almighty, He is more than able to care for His children, and He is all-sufficient for our needs! He hears you and He is ready to act on your behalf. So, there is no excuse to not pray for our world and the people in it. Where I went to Bible College we had a class on Missions around the world, and the textbook for the class was a yearly prayer book that had us pray for a certain country every day. It told us some facts about the country and some of its specific needs. I don't know if you could ever find a book like that, but I challenge you to personally pray for the world every day. You can pray for certain countries, and also pray for those you might see on the news that are going through horrible atrocities. Trust that God hears your prayers for He is the Almighty.

Our verse for today might help us in our prayers for the world. This verse comes from Matthew 6 where Jesus was teaching about prayer and fasting at the Sermon on the Mount. Many of you might know it from the "Lord's Prayer". Here is where we are asking for the establishment of God's rule, not only in its fulfillment in the Age to Come, but also in lives and situations in the present. Be encouraged that God hears your prays, and is ready to act Today​ for whatever you ask!

There is only a few days left of the Fast, and even though the Fast will be over, continue to pray everyday. Stay devoted to your prayer life. Jesus presents devotion as a matter of the heart. Devotion is a matter of developing an intimate relationship with the living God. Devote yourself to God today. He is chasing after you.
